Press ups aren't enough to build mass, Puff, you'll only be doing maybe 50kg max. Tone, yes. Mass, no. Plus once you can't do another rep, you stop. The way to build size is to go beyond that point. Aim to bench press your bodyweight for about six reps (with a few assisted), and to squat about 1.25x your bodyweight for similar reps. Do situps if you must, but again that has little or nothing to do with putting on size.
